Notice
Recent Posts
Recent Comments
Link
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| |||||
3 | 4 | 5 | 6 | 7 | 8 | 9 |
10 | 11 | 12 | 13 | 14 | 15 | 16 |
17 | 18 | 19 | 20 | 21 | 22 | 23 |
24 | 25 | 26 | 27 | 28 | 29 | 30 |
Tags
- 도커
- 메모이제이션
- 유레카
- docker-compose
- spring boot
- 이분 매칭
- dp
- Logback
- 이분 탐색
- 스택
- 트리
- 플로이드 와샬
- Gradle
- 다익스트라
- 달팽이
- 구간 트리
- Java
- ZuulFilter
- 구현
- spring cloud
- 서비스 디스커버리
- Zuul
- 비트마스킹
- 백트래킹
- Spring Cloud Config
- 주울
- BFS
- 스프링 시큐리티
- 완전 탐색
- 게이트웨이
Archives
- Today
- Total
Hello, Freakin world!
[Java][logback] 간단하게 런타임 중 logging level 설정하기 본문
간단하게 클래스 개별 테스트를 진행한다면 이 방법으로 충분하다.
하지만 로그들을 전체적으로 관리하려면 이 방법보다는 설정 xml 파일을 따로 작성하자.
import ch.qos.logback.classic.Level;
import ch.qos.logback.classic.Logger;
import ch.qos.logback.classic.LoggerContext;
import org.junit.Test;
import org.slf4j.LoggerFactory;
public class LogExample {
LoggerContext lc = (LoggerContext) LoggerFactory.getILoggerFactory();
Logger logger = lc.getLogger(LogExample.class);
public void setLogLevel(Level logLevel) {
logger.setLevel(logLevel);
}
@Test
public void main() {
setLogLevel(Level.INFO);
logger.debug("hello, debug mode");
logger.info("hello, info mode");
}
}
'프로그래밍 언어 > Java' 카테고리의 다른 글
[Java][NIO] channel 객체를 Selector 객체에 등록하는 경우 (0) | 2020.03.14 |
---|---|
[Java][Gson] Gson 라이브러리 메모 (0) | 2020.03.10 |
[Java][NIO] Selector 정리 (0) | 2020.03.07 |
[Java][logback] Gradle로 import하기 (0) | 2020.02.12 |
[JavaFX] FXML 상의 컴포넌트를 Java Controller 의 필드에 바인딩하기 (0) | 2020.01.25 |
Comments